We are seeking for Technical Specialists with 5+ years of experience in J2EE Java-based software development to support Integrated Employment Services. The role involves Curam development, software design, system integration, troubleshooting, and Agile methodologies to enhance case management and ERP systems.

Responsibilities
•Translate technical specifications into working applications.
•Develop, test, and deploy software using J2EE, Java, SQL, and RESTful APIs.
•Resolve technical issues and support production systems.
•Implement system integrations using SOAP, RESTful web services, messaging, and SFTP.
•Work with relational and hierarchical database technologies (Oracle, SQL).
•Implement continuous integration and deployment (CI/CD) pipelines.
•Manage Linux/Unix environments, Git repositories, and version control.
•Collaborate with IT teams throughout the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C).
•Conduct design walkthroughs and document technical solutions.
•Ensure compliance with Accessibility for Ontarians with Disability Act (AODA).
Qualifications
•5+ years of experience in J2EE Java-based software development.
•Hands-on experience with Curam Social Program Management (SPM) platform.
•Proficiency in Apache Ant, Maven, Tomcat, WebLogic, and WebSphere.
•Experience with SOAP, RESTful APIs, messaging, and integration technologies.
•Familiarity with Linux/Unix, Git, and cloud platforms like Azure.
•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ills.
•Excellent communication and teamwork abilities.
•Ability to manage complex projects within deadlines.
•Curam V7 Certified Developer certification.
•Experience with Docker, Kubernetes, and Azure DevOps.
•Knowledge of Agile methodologies and risk management.
